Ancient health experts in China believed that people's sleeping direction should change with the alternation of spring, summer, autumn and winter. "When you are busy at four o'clock, you lie down", and the direction of sleep also corresponds to the solar terms at that time. Therefore, there are theories about the orientation of the bedside when sleeping, such as spring east, summer south, autumn west and winter north.

Looking up relevant information, it is found that people have endless opinions on the problem of bedside orientation. In addition to seasonal changes, some people think that the bedside should not face west, because this will make the direction of human body position movement opposite to the direction of the earth's rotation, making the human body feel uncomfortable.

It is also said that the human body should sleep with its head facing north and its feet facing south, which is consistent with the direction of the earth's magnetic field. This kind of sleep mode in line with the direction of the earth's magnetic field can reduce the influence of geomagnetic field on human body, thus helping people to keep a good sleep. But according to experts, all these statements have no scientific basis.

Sun Simiao, a medical scientist in the Tang Dynasty, also said in "Thousands of Women": "Ordinary people lie down, facing east in spring and summer, and facing west in autumn and winter. Don't lie on your back or sleep on the north side of the wall. " Due to the limitations of ancient people's understanding, this statement is unscientific. Sleep is related to many factors, such as mood and psychology, and it is not just changing the orientation of sleep that can solve the problem of sleep disorder.

Although it is meaningless to change the orientation of the bedside to improve the quality of sleep, it is helpful to provide yourself with a comfortable and quiet natural environment for high-quality sleep.

Grasping the temperature and light in the bedroom will help you have a good sleep. People's body temperature will automatically adjust according to the biological clock. At night, the human body enters a quiet state, and the body temperature will also drop. It is generally believed that 23℃ is the best sleeping temperature, at which people feel the warmest and most comfortable.

In addition, indoor humidity also has a certain impact on sleep quality, but the human body will gradually adapt to the environment over time, and it will not have a significant impact after a long time. It is suggested that the temperature and humidity should be adjusted to a comfortable standard according to personal conditions.

The darker the light, the more helpful it is to sleep. If you want to have a good sleep, it is best to reduce the brightness of the whole room before going to bed, so that the brain can gradually accept a slightly dark environment and enter the preparation period of sleep, which will help relieve insomnia. In addition, it is recommended to choose light pink, light blue and other colors that make people feel relaxed and quiet, rather than red and other colors that make people nervous.

For people with high requirements for sleeping environment, the overall color system of the bedroom will also have an impact on sleeping conditions. It is generally believed that beige and light blue are the most helpful for sleep. Beige is the mildest of all colors and is suitable for use in the bedroom. Blue can relieve tension. People who are prone to insomnia, it is best not to use colorful and complicated wallpaper in the bedroom.

The comfort of pillow has a certain influence on sleep quality. When choosing a pillow, you should pay attention to softness, breathability and height. Don't care too much about materials and don't be confused by some concepts. The human body has an adaptability to pillows, and a good pillow should be consistent with your accustomed sleeping position.

There are three elements of healthy sleep, including sleep duration (7 hours for adults), sleep timing (falling asleep the night before) and sleep quality (normal sleep structure).

The basis of healthy sleep should be mental health, happiness and the law of life. It is suggested that the quality of sleep can be improved by doing more outdoor activities, eating regularly and using drugs reasonably. If necessary, you should seek medical attention in time, find out the reasons and improve your sleep by scientific methods.
